Regulatory Frameworks: Balancing Economic Growth and Ecological Sustainability

The delicate equilibrium between fostering economic growth and safeguarding ecological sustainability is a persistent challenge for governments. Stringent environmental regulations can sometimes restrict industrial development and business expansion, raising concerns about job opportunities. Conversely, lax regulations can cause unchecked pollution, threatening the long-term health of our planet. Finding this balanced approach requires a integrated strategy that evaluates both economic and environmental factors. This may entail innovative technologies, market-based incentives, and public awareness initiatives to promote sustainable practices and foster a vibrant economy that respects ecological boundaries.

Emerging Trends in Global Environmental Regulation

Environmental policy progresses rapidly on a global scale, driven by growing concerns about climate change and biodiversity loss. Countries are increasingly collaborating to establish comprehensive environmental regulations that aim to address these challenges.

One notable trend is the rise of voluntary frameworks that encourage businesses and industries to adopt sustainable practices. Moreover, there's a growing emphasis on incorporating local knowledge into environmental decision-making processes. Technological advancements, such as blockchain and artificial intelligence, are also playing a prominent role in enhancing transparency and assessing environmental impacts.

In conclusion, the future of global environmental regulation rests on continued international cooperation, innovative policy solutions, and a shared commitment to protecting our planet for generations to come.
